A. Introduction
The WelVac 200 Vacuum Manifold is designed for the rapid preparation of plasmid DNA,
single-stranded phage DNA, RNA, genomic DNA, viral nucleic acids, DNA cleanup from
PCR and other enzymatic reactions. For most protocols, the WelVac 200 eliminates the
need for time-consuming pipetting and centrifugation. The manifold reduces sample
handling to a minimum by allowing direct parallel and simultaneous processing of up to 24
mini columns, 8 midi or maxi columns, and 96-well plates.
In addition, patent-pending technology from ROCKER eliminates the need for separate
manifolds, with the new vacuum manifold and column adaptor board. This vacuum system
allows a single vacuum manifold to serve as a purification platform for either 96-well plates
or individual luer-ended columns. It is especially ideal for those laboratories requiring to
save time and space.

H. Operation
I. Set the vacuum manifold to a desired vacuum before filtration.
Important Notice:
Appropriate vacuum degree is a key point to get efficient extraction. We suggest
setting the system of the vacuum degree in your protocol before filtration.
1. Close the vent on the WelVac 200 (See Fig. 1) and put column adaptor board with
Luer stopper on the gasket of the upper chamber. (See Fig. 2)
2. Set the vacuum regulator (anticlockwise) to open position and turn on the vacuum
pump. (See Fig. 3)
3. Adjust the vacuum regulator (clockwise) to the desired setting of vacuum degree then
turn off the vacuum pump.(See Fig. 3)
Note: Push the adaptor board lightly to ensure the manifold sealed when
adjusting.
4. Open the vent on the WelVac 200 to release preassure, remove the column adaptor
board and then close the vent again.
5. Now, the vacuum manifold is set up and ready to use.
Note: WelVac 200 also can be connected to local stationary vacuum source with
optional vacuum regulator (Optional, 195200-38) to adjust vacuum degree.
II. 96-well plates extraction
1. Remove the upper chamber and put a waste tray into the lower chamber.
2. Replace the upper chamber and put the filter plate on the gasket.
Note: Please ensure that the gasket is clean and the vent is on the off position.
(see Fig. 1)
3. When ready to extract, please turn on the vacuum pump power switch and press
lightly on the filter plate to engage the vacuum seal.
Note: Make sure that the filter plate fits tightly on the gasket of the
WelVac 200.

4. The manifold is now ready for filter plate processing according to the vacuum
protocol of the appropriate purification kit.
Note: If you need to regulate the vacuum pressure, please adjust the
regulator.
5. When finished, please turn off the vacuum pump power switch and open the vent to
release the residual vacuum pressure to avoid the potential of filtrate sprayed out.
(cross-contamination)
Note: Do not release the pressure by opening the corner of the filter plate to
prevent deformation of the manifold gasket.
Note: You can also tap the top of the filter plate prior to remove residual
droplets in the bottom of the tube.
6. Remove the filter plate and put it aside for further processing or dispose of it
properly.
7. Remove the upper chamber and the waste tray and utilize the waste for further
processing.
8. After finished, please rinse the WelVac 200 vacuum manifold with water and either
air dry or wipe with paper towels.
Note: Failure to rinse the vacuum manifold at the end of each use will cause it
become cloudy and pitted.
Note: Please avoid using organic solvent to clean.
III. Spin columns extraction
1. Remove the upper chamber and put a waste tray into the lower chamber or connect
a waste bottle (Optional, 167200-31 1000ml) between the manifold and vacuum
pump.
2. Replace the upper chamber and put the column adaptor board on the gasket.
Note: Please ensure that the gasket is clean and the vent is on the off position.
(see Figure 1)
3. Insert the spin columns firmly into the luer connectors, place them into the holes on
the column adaptor board and then insert the luer stoppers into other unused one.
(see Figure 5)
Note: Confirm the same type columns to avoid the different flow rates and
ensure the stable filtration rate.

4. When ready to extract, please turn on the vacuum pump power switch and press
lightly on the column adaptor board to engage the vacuum seal.
Note: Make sure that the column adaptor board fits tightly on the gasket of
the WelVac 200.
5. The manifold is now ready for column processing according to the vacuum protocol
of the appropriate purification kit.
Note: If you need to regulate the vacuum pressure, please adjust the
regulator.
6. When finished, please turn off the vacuum pump power switch and open the vent to
release the residual vacuum pressure to avoid the potential of filtrate sprayed out.
(cross-contamination)
Note: Do not release the pressure by opening the corner of the column
adaptor board to prevent deformation of the manifold gasket.
Note: You can also tap the top of the column adaptor board prior to remove
residual droplets in the bottom of the tube.
7. Remove the column adaptor board and put it aside for further processing or dispose
of the spin columns properly.
8. Remove the upper chamber and the waste tray and then utilize the waste for further
processing.
9. After finished, please rinse the WelVac 200 vacuum manifold with water and either
air dry or wipe with paper towels.
Note: Failure to rinse the vacuum manifold at the end of each use will cause it
to be cloudy and pitted.
Note: Please avoid using organic solvent to clean.
IV. Replace the O-ring
When O-ring aged and vacuum can’t be achieved, replacing a new one.
1. Remove existing O-ring from the bottom of the upper chamber.(see Figure 6)
2. Ensure that the new O-ring is free from dirt, debris, and particulate matter.
3. Replace the new O-ring.
Note: When change O-ring, gasket should be replaced at the same time.

V. Replace the Gasket
When Gasket aged and vacuum can’t be achieved, replacing a new one.
1. Remove the 12 screws located on the bottom portion of the upper chamber by Allen
wrench.(see Fig. 6)
2. Separate the top ring from the upper chamber.
3. Remove the old gasket and then clean the top ring groove.
4. Put the new gasket into the groove and put back the top ring.
Note: Ensure that the bottom of the top ring groove is aligned cover gasket.
5. Replace the 12 screws and tighten the four corner screws lightly and then lock all
other screws.
Note: Do not lock too tight to avoid the top ring distortion and lead a pool
airtight.
Note: When change gasket, O-ring should be replaced at the same time.

I. Maintaining
1. Please do the cleaning after each use to remove salts and buffer.
Note: Do not use any solvents include bleach or abrasives.
2. If the gasket, O-ring are aged or damaged, please replace it.
Note: Do not smear any silicone oil or vacuum grease to the gaskets or other
parts of the WelVac 200 vacuum manifold.
3. Prohibiting contact with any strong chemical reagents to avoid the damage of the
WelVac 200 Vacuum Manifold.
J. Troubleshooting
Possible cause suggestions
Poor airtight 1. Confirmed the O-ring and gasket are clean or has been
damaged.
2. Close the vacuum regulator. (clockwise)
3. Close the vent.
4. Check the tightness of the Luer connector or Luer stopper.
5. Ensure all unused luer connectors are replaced by luer stoppers.
6. Ensure uniform contact between upper chamber and low
chamber.
7. Press lightly on the filter plate or column adaptor board to
engage the vacuum seal.
8. Check the filter plates or column adaptor board for cracks.
9. Ensure the vacuum connector and silicone tube are not loose or
damaged.
Vacuum pump
is too weak 1. Replace a new vacuum source or wait for some time to generate
sufficient vacuum pressure.
